Is there a deadline to file a burn injury lawsuit in Nevada?

Nevada's statute of limitations for most burn injury lawsuits is two years from when the harm occurred. Waiting past the cutoff almost always results in losing your right to sue. Certain exceptions apply for minor victims, which is one more reason to consult a burn injury lawyer promptly.

Does shared fault affect my burn injury claim?

Nevada follows a modified comparative negligence rule. Under this standard, you can receive damages as long as you are not the majority responsible party. However, your final recovery will be reduced by your share of responsibility. A burn injury lawyer helps evaluate to protect your recovery against unfair blame.
